Output 25b8f77d9f3d7a4e91e7c8f1b4da50a4e25155a7463a99d90bf7f23065136a05:0

value
6641318292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e260ed8d6ea154e40e6353f56c452cff99b8b960 OP_EQUALVERIFY OP_CHECKSIG
address
1Mdyq2SzFaSEo97wqWvYz4HPuFvLKStqhs
transaction
25b8f77d9f3d7a4e91e7c8f1b4da50a4e25155a7463a99d90bf7f23065136a05
spent
true